Fanby RetroesqueComment: Nice composing with the way the circles are a bit off center. lots of lines and curves and a very metallic look to it too. These ventilators have been around for a long time, and the wind turns them and makes them pull hot air out of a building. They are a very energy efficient (green) way of helping cool a place, and help to keep humidity lower inside. Most of these have a shutter that can be closed when it is cold outside.
I never would have thought to photograph one from directly below for it's graphic quality. |
